    Leading English badminton international Donna Kellogg, the 2008 European mixed doubles champion with Anthony Clark, is to retire.

    Kellogg, 31, announced her decision after arriving home from the China Open. She will play one last event if she receives, as expected, an invitation to the World Super Series Masters Finals in Malaysia from December 2-6.

    She won 11 English national titles, the first in 1998 with women's doubles partner Joanne Goode. The pair also captured Commonwealth Games gold that year and followed up with victory in the European championships final in 2000.

    In 2006 Kellogg won the European title again, this time with Gail Emms. In the same year she also took mixed doubles silver with Clark at the world championships in Madrid.
